The Manel Xifra and Boada awards recognize Tomàs Molina

On Thursday, the handing over ceremony was held Manel Xifra and Boada awards, which have reached their eighteenth edition. The purpose of these awards is highlight those people and researchers who have made contributions to the field of engineering and scientific and technical knowledge.

The Awards, which are promoted by GI ENGINEERS i eat, have been delivered to the Manel Xifra i Boada Auditorium, located in the Science and Technology Park of the University of Girona. During the ceremony, the importance of promoting technical vocationsespecially among women, and the problem of the climate change, especially the current drought situation. The Councilor of Universities, Joaquim Nadal, and the president of the Provincial Council of Girona, Miquel Noguer, were some of the prominent institutional representatives present at the event.

The meteorologist Tomàs Molina i Boschgraduate in physics and journalist, has been awarded with the Manel Xifra i Boada Award for the transfer of technical and technological knowledge. Molina is an associate professor at the University of Barcelona and ambassador of the European Climate Pact of the European Union. “His work as a publicist should also be highlighted, including his role as an influencer on Instagram, a platform that allows him to reach a young audience,” the organization notes. After receiving the award, he gave a lecture on meteorology and the consequences of climate change.

The Barcelona Supercomputing Center (BSC-CNS) has received the Manel Xifra and Boada Award to the Applied Research Group or Technological Center. Mariona Sanz, head of innovation and business development at the BSC, has collected the award on behalf of the institution. The BSC-CNS is a specialist in high-performance computing and manages the MareNostrum, one of the most powerful supercomputers in Europe. The center offers services to the international scientific community and industry. Since its creation in 2005, the BSC-CNS has promoted high computing as a key tool for international competitiveness in science and engineering. The center also manages the Spanish Supercomputing Network and is a member of the Partnership for Advanced Computing in Europe (PRACE) initiative.

Lifetime Achievement Award

He The Manel Xifra i Boada Professional Career Award has been awarded to Jordi Forga Oliveras. His daughter Montse Forga has collected the award. Forga is a mechanical industrial expert from the Terrassa school in 1969, and later a technical industrial engineer from the UdG in 1978. He was also accredited as a superior technician in occupational risk prevention and as an insurance appraiser. His professional career is linked to Comforsa between the years 1970 and 1990, and later to his own technical office.

As for the Manel Xifra and Boada awards in recognition of those awarded by the Board of Trustees of the Superior Polytechnic School of the University of Girona (UdG) with qualifications related to Engineering, Adrià Tort Serra, a graduate in Industrial Electronics and Automation Engineering, was recognized for his final degree project “Development of a wireless sensor node for electronics practices”; Carla Santiago Corral, double graduate in Industrial Technology Engineering and ADE for the final degree thesis “Optimization of the extrusion system and determination of process parameters for the 3D printing of high concentration silk fibroin”; Marc Duran Pérez, graduate in Mechanical Engineering, for the thesis “Model for the analysis of the movement of a swing”; Irene Barnosell Roura, graduate in Chemical Engineering, for the thesis “Contribution of the European Chemical Industry to the Planetary Boundaries”; Marc Crous Sabidó, graduate in Mechanical Engineering, for the Bachelor thesis “Design of a box depalletizing machine for the meat industry”; and Paula Jorquera Martín, graduate in Industrial Technologies Engineering, for the thesis “Design of a prototype to move a mannequin used in the preparation of radiotherapy treatments”.
